Comparison review

Galaxy S6 Edge is better than the Samsung Galaxy A02s, with an 85.7 score against 74.5. These phones work with Android OS (Operating System), but Galaxy S6 Edge has an older 5.0 version while Samsung Galaxy A02s has Android 11. Although the Galaxy S6 Edge is notably older than the Samsung Galaxy A02s, it's design is a lot thinner and a lot lighter.

The Galaxy S6 Edge features a way better looking screen than Samsung Galaxy A02s, because although it has a much smaller screen, it also counts with much more pixels per inch of display and a much better 2560 x 1440 resolution.
